Sou fotógrafo documental e editorial de A Haia. Atuo mundialmente para revistas, agências de publicidade, arquitetos e clientes comerciais. Além disso, desenvolvo projetos pessoais como Rear Window, sobre o qual tenho fotografado a visão traseira de edifícios em todo o mundo desde 2010.
Amsterdam was the first city I captured for the series.

In urban planning, architects often pay great attention to the design of a building's front, while the rear is overlooked.

Rear views of homes in older cities often evolve more organically, as neat layouts are disrupted by encroaching greenery. A balcony might host a large satellite dish while an adjacent landing serves as storage space. In Southeast Asia, air conditioning units form their own façade; in Northern Europe, a Christmas tree planted in a courtyard has grown into a massive obstacle.

This series explores the backs of buildings in metropolises worldwide, revealing international differences and the resulting global chaos.
